BT Alex Brown Downgrade of SCI is 2nd in 2 weeks

Rosemary, last week, Lehman Bros took SCI Systems rating
down a notch, from a category 1 to a 2 (not sure what
that means except it's not a positive), and today BT
Alex Brown reduced it from a strong buy to a buy. Price
looks very attractive at $37 and change, and last time
I looked people were still buying computers. SCI still
has very aggressive expansion plans in place, which
should bode well for the future. Judging from ECM
sector weakness though, looks like no big compulsion
to buy at this point by powers that be, so end of March/
portfolio window dressing might end up offering an even
more attractive price. If you put in a low-ball limit
order you might be surprised at what you might get this
stock at. If you can overlook short-term weakness in
this stock, SCI should do well for you if your timeframe
is one or two years out. Just my two cents. Peter.
